| Database ManagementLN data is stored in database tables. LN supports
several Relational Database Management Systems (RDBMSs). To access a database,
the LN users
must be authorized to access the RDBMS. You must specify database information for each database type
used by LN.
During setup you also must create a database definition and assign tables to
it. The client/server architecture as supported by Tools enables the user to
work with several database types. These databases can be distributed over one
or multiple systems. A configuration where databases are distributed over
multiple systems is called a remote database configuration. In an LN installation with multiple companies, you can require two or more companies to share
tables to meet a particular business requirement. For example, if several of
your companies purchase items from the same suppliers, these companies can
share the business-partner table. The Database Administrator (DBA) module is used by the database administrator to
create, maintain, and view links between LN users and database users, database groups, and the
tables and indexes repository in the databases.
